Preseason Ponderings

Well the Bears won 10-3 in a scrappy penalty filled first pre-season game against the Bills. Some good some bad, pretty much what ya expect from a first exhibition game especially with such a short camp.



The OL was horrible. 9 sacks against a pretty poor Bills team. J'Marcus Webb was not good in his first action at LT with drug free Shawn Merriman simply pushing him aside. Garza was poor at C and Spencer should start seeing time there.

khalil Bell & Marion Barber had outstanding days. Barber had runs of 11, 15 & 11 & Bell led the team with 73 yards. Harvey Unga saw time in the 4th & ran hard. Taylors time could be over.




It was strange seeing big plays from a number 91 but Okoye had an impressive debut & Melton continued to impress. Wouldn't surprise meto see Melton starting week 1.
Corey Wootton got hurt on the opening kick-off & saw no further action in the game.

Rookie Kris Adams had an impressive game with 2 great catches & rookie S Michael Holmes had an int to top of a nice game.


Johnny Knox showed why he'll see time on KR this year blazing a 70 yard return while Earl Bennett had a 33 yard PR. The Bears are very stacked at returner







Sam Hurd caused a fumble on a kick return but it was nullified by a penalty.

Robbie Gould missed 2 field goals & the special teams unit as a whole had numerous penalties lets hope it's just a matter of gettiing used to new rules & a new holder.

Looking forward to the Giants game to see if the RB's can have another good game & the OL improves any.
